Mixed reactions as Ilebaye’s father arrested over alleged assault

NewsdeskBy NewsdeskMay 11, 2026Updated:May 11, 2026No Comments3 Mins Read
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

Reactions from social media users have continued to flood online platforms following reports of the assault on Ilebaye Odiniya, winner of the 2023 Big Brother Naija All Stars edition, by her father, Emmanuel Odiniya.

The issue generated public outrage on Saturday after the 25-year-old reality star cried out for help during a distressed Instagram Live session.

In the viral video, Ilebaye was seen crying with visible swelling on her face, sparking widespread condemnation across social media.

The Federal Capital Territory Police Command, in a statement, confirmed the arrest of the celebrity’s father, adding that investigations are ongoing and that justice will be served. The police also revealed that Ilebaye is currently receiving treatment in a medical facility in the FCT.

As events continue to unfold, many social media users and celebrities have expressed outrage, prompting renewed conversations about domestic violence.

While some netizens, particularly Ilebaye’s fans, called for a thorough investigation and strict sanctions, others urged calm and family reconciliation, claiming the father was only “disciplining” his child.

However, BBNaija Level Up winner (2022), Ijeoma Otabor, popularly known as Phyna, slammed those condemning the father.

In an Instagram Live session, Phyna said the issue is a family matter and urged netizens to be mindful of their comments.

“People should be mindful of what they say about this Ilebaye and her father case. It’s a family thing,” she said.
